#ff36c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ff36cc is composed of 100% red, 21.2%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 20%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 315.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 60.6%. #ff36c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#ff0099.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#ff36cc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ff36cc has RGB values of R:255, G:54,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.2, K:0. Its decimal value is 16725708.

Hex triplet ff36cc #ff36cc
RGB Decimal 255, 54, 204 rgb(255,54,204)
RGB Percent 100, 21.2, 80 rgb(100%,21.2%,80%)
CMYK 0, 79, 20, 0
HSL 315.2°, 100, 60.6 hsl(315.2,100%,60.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 315.2°, 78.8, 100
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 60.125, 84.601, -32.502
XYZ 53.458, 28.263, 59.763
xyY 0.378, 0.2, 28.263
CIE-LCH 60.125, 90.629, 338.984
CIE-LUV 60.125, 99.88, -63.307
Hunter-Lab 53.163, 86.459, -29.438
Binary 11111111, 00110110, 11001100

Shades and Tints of #ff36c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f000b is the darkest color, while #fffafe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ff36cc is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#838383 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9c7492 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5d93ff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8f94bd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f5656b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9871ec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b771c2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f9548e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
